Transaction eec5e0664c6c5f7f9eccf416efef13d3f3eae274d0c01d1926fce7bbbaaa9f74

block
e09591ab000c2be38f405846d65fd794dfa1200e435a896f65cf91f77de5e728

1 Input

25 Outputs